[闲聊] Swift 将成 Android 发展新动力

楼主: RX1226 (NO KING)   2017-04-14 21:31:34
刚看到这篇新闻
"不用分那么细,iOS 核心语言 Swift 将成 Android 发展新动力!"
https://qooah.com/2017/04/14/ios-swift-for-android/
所以之后要开始用Swift写Android了?
不知道多快之内就会发生?
而且也不知道导入要多久
作者: cha122977 (CHA)   2017-04-15 06:35:00
不就一间学校开了门课吗…
作者: ssccg (23)   2017-04-15 07:05:00
这篇不知道在写什么...连Java和JVM(android上是ART)都分不清楚,还在谈语言执行效率...看了一下课程介绍应该是把swift compile成java bytecode开发方式类似Xamarin,只是执行环境用原生的不另起一套VM后面几段都是这篇的作者的个人意见,跟这课程没关系
作者: Neisseria (Neisseria)   2017-04-15 07:43:00
目前是有一些零星的新闻在谈用 Swift 开发 Android仅止于新闻,不用认真。Google 不会没弄 API 就发布这样的消息。换语言等于整个生态圈砍掉重练另一个消息是用 Kotlin,也是看看就好
作者: ssccg (23)   2017-04-15 08:01:00
用Kotlin不用特别做什么,一样是JVM语言,IDE和build系统也已经支援Kotlin(毕竟是Jetbrains自己的东西)本篇的Swift课程应该也是特制的IDE达成一样的流程都没动到Android SDK(Java写的)的class,就从别的语言使用
作者: Neisseria (Neisseria)   2017-04-15 09:05:00
推 s 大,我也觉得是用特制 IDE 来处理平台议题
作者: y3k (激流を制するは静水)   2017-04-15 11:40:00
很久以前就有人在用C#开发Android了
作者: zcbxvsdf (东北一头羊)   2017-04-15 15:29:00
补习班耸动文章
楼主: RX1226 (NO KING)   2017-04-15 23:00:00
谢谢大大们的经验分享~~!!
作者: chenx5 (ccchaha)   2017-04-16 10:52:00
老实说,外面的公司还是用java写,如果是自己玩就没什么关系
作者: ggttoo44 (thai)   2017-04-16 15:41:00
js,c#,swift都想用自己惯用的语言取代android原生开发方式,是java学习曲线太难还是android原生学习曲线太难?
作者: y3k (激流を制するは静水)   2017-04-17 00:20:00
稍早之前其实还有BASIC、我记得甚至连FORTRAN都有XD 只是要开发"产品" 到头来还是直接用原生最好 这不论开发什么都一样的
作者: ssccg (23)   2017-04-17 02:06:00
都不是,通常是为了在多个平台用同样的语言开发虽然很多UI元件不能共通,但像business logic、接后端之类的可以重复利用...用JVM语言的像Kotlin、Groovy甚至Scala那种才是嫌Java的
作者: deepkh (科科将)   2017-04-19 23:59:00
Java很old school,冗长.go python swift有效率多了

Links booklink

Contact Us: admin [ a t ] ucptt.com